Common Pigweed

Common pigweed is a prevalent weed known for causing allergic reactions in late summer and fall. Its pollen can be highly allergenic and is a common cause of hay fever and other allergic symptoms. Those sensitive to pigweed pollen may experience reactions during its peak pollination period....

When should I consider testing for Common Pigweed allergy?

If you have hay fever symptoms that align with pigweed’s pollination season, usually late summer to fall, consider an allergy test to confirm sensitivity.

Why does Common Pigweed cause allergies?

Common Pigweed releases large amounts of pollen into the air, which can trigger an immune response in sensitive individuals, leading to allergic symptoms.

How to reduce exposure to Common Pigweed pollen?

Stay indoors with windows closed during peak pollen times, use air purifiers, and shower after being outside to remove pollen from skin and hair.
